Shidduch Incentive Program

Status: Program ran from 2004-2009 (5 years); appears to be concluded as of the content date.

Overview: STAR-K's Shidduch Incentive Program offered a cash gift to shadchanim (matchmakers) who successfully matched Orthodox single women.

Geographic Scope: Baltimore, Maryland (local program with worldwide impact)

Focus Areas: Jewish community support; addressing the Orthodox singles crisis

Award Details:

  • Initial award: $2,500 per successful match

  • Effective January 1, 2010, shadchanim had to receive a minimum shadchanus fee of $1,500 paid by the choson (groom) and kallah (bride) or their families to qualify for the STAR-K award

  • Program paid out $367,000 total to those who successfully arranged shidduchim for 152 local women over its 5-year run
  • Eligibility: Shadchanim matching Orthodox single women by Chanukah (initial deadline was 2009)

    Background: A local attempt at remedying the universal Orthodox singles problem in Baltimore that had widespread impact and became motivating factor in matching single Orthodox women around the world.
